The context behind the number

Used twice a week for ten years, a $749 Dyson costs about 72 cents per use. The time saved vs. a cheaper corded vacuum often recoups its own work-hour cost within two years.

How we calculate the time-cost

  1. 1We start with your net take-home income — what actually lands in your bank account after taxes, social contributions, and mandatory deductions.
  2. 2We divide that by your real working hours per week, including overtime, commuting, and any unpaid work preparation, to arrive at your true hourly wage.
  3. 3We then divide the item price by your true hourly wage to get the raw number of work-hours the purchase costs.
  4. 4Finally, we convert those hours into a human-readable breakdown of years, months, days, and hours so you can immediately feel the weight of the number.

This approach follows the methodology described in "Your Money or Your Life" by Vicki Robin — one of the foundational texts of the financial independence movement.
